The westinghouse aviation gas turbine division agt was established by westinghouse electric corporation in 1945 to continue the development and production of its turbo jet gas turbine engines for aircraft propulsion under contract to the us navy bureau of aeronautics. Using language understandable to those without an engineering background and avoiding complex mathematical formulae, bill gunston explains the differences between gas turbine, jet, rocket, ramjet and helicopter turboshaft aero engines and traces their histories from the early days through to todays complex and powerful units as used in the latest widebodied airliners and high performance. A turboprop engine is a turbine engine that drives an aircraft propeller a turboprop consists of an intake, reduction gearbox, compressor, combustor, turbine, and a propelling nozzle.
